在Ubuntu环境下配置和保护Gitea的安全性有几个重要的措施可以采取:
使用HTTPS协议:为Gitea配置SSL证书,以使用HTTPS协议进行数据传输,确保数据在传输过程中的加密安全。
设置防火墙规则:使用防火墙工具如ufw或iptables来限制外部访问Gitea的端口,只允许特定IP范围或特定IP访问Gitea服务。
使用SSH密钥认证:在Gitea上配置SSH密钥认证,使用公钥和私钥对用户进行身份验证,避免使用密码登录,提高安全性。
定期备份数据:定期备份Gitea的数据,包括数据库和仓库文件,以防止数据丢失或损坏。
更新和升级:定期检查Gitea官方发布的更新和补丁,及时升级Gitea版本,以修复已知的安全漏洞。
使用安全密码策略:要求用户使用安全复杂的密码,并定期更改密码,以增加账户安全性。
通过以上措施的实施,可以有效提高Gitea在Ubuntu环境下的安全性,保护用户的数据和信息不受恶意攻击。